We are currently seeking a Clinical Research Associate II Specialist to join our diverse and dynamic team. As a Clinical Research Associate II Specialist at ICON, you will play a pivotal role in designing and analyzing clinical trials, interpreting complex medical data, and contributing to the advancement of innovative treatments and therapies

What You Will Be Doing:

  • Conducting site qualification, initiation, monitoring, and close-out visits for clinical trials.
  • Ensuring protocol compliance, data integrity, and patient safety throughout the trial process.
  • Collaborating with investigators and site staff to facilitate smooth study conduct.
  • Performing data review and resolution of queries to maintain high-quality clinical data.
  • Contributing to the preparation and review of study documentation, including protocols and clinical study reports

Your Profile::

  • Bachelor's degree in a scientific or healthcare-related field.
  • Minimum of 2 years of experience as a Clinical Research Associate.
  • In-depth knowledge of clinical trial processes, regulations, and ICH-GCP guidelines.
  • Strong organizational and communication skills, with attention to detail.
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a fast-paced environment.
